Know the regulations that actually control your move
Before you value a service provider or choose dates, validate what your orders and service plans cover. An independently possessed vehicle can be shipped at federal government expenditure for lots of abroad projects. For the majority of continental steps, the government does not pay to move your vehicle unless you certify under particular scenarios, such as specific clinical or challenge exemptions. Households frequently drive one POV and ship the various other at their own expenditure, fold the cars and truck right into a Personally Bought Relocate, or market a car and buy at the brand-new duty station. The appropriate selection depends upon distance, timeline, and the condition of the vehicle.
When you are OCONUS, enjoy the fine print. Some commands permit shipment of one POV at government expense per active service participant. Others limit the size, weight, or alterations. A raised vehicle that ran fine in Texas might not clear port rules in Germany. In Japan and South Korea, emissions and lights standards can need little changes. Timelines are various too. Transoceanic automobile transportation generally runs 30 to 60 days port to port. If you are island bound, trust the lengthy end of that array and pad for weather.
For CONUS transfers, the business economics drive the choice. If you require to be at the new responsibility station in three days and your spouse is managing kids and family pets, delivering a 2nd vehicle can be a sanity saver. Anticipate domestic automobile transportation to cost anywhere from 50 cents to 1.25 dollars per mile in common lanes, with greater prices in winter months or for remote pick-up and delivery. A portable car from Virginia to Texas in spring can land in the 900 to 1,200 dollar variety. A heavy SUV throughout a January cold snap can damage 1,800 dollars for the very same lane.
The computer timeline, and where the vehicle fits
The rhythm of a PCS seldom matches the rhythm of a carrier route. Household items lots on day one, you clear housing on day two, and you start the drive day three. Vehicle carriers want a versatile pick-up home window of 2 to 5 days and often call with a half day of notification to confirm. If you attempt to force a surgical pickup at 10 a.m. Tuesday the 5th, you will pay a premium or watch the dispatch slip.
Work backwards from your report date. If you are driving one POV, map the path and examine institution or pet needs that could slow you down. If you are delivering a car, provide on your own a 3 to seven day pickup window that ends before your last day in housing. You do not intend to hand the secrets to a motorist on the curb while removing final examination. If that is inescapable, prearrange base access and a handoff place. I have utilized the site visitor center car park outside eviction and a colleague's driveway. Both needed extra call and an authorized restricted power of lawyer so a close friend might launch the vehicle. It deserved the hassle.
Delivery home windows vary also. For cross nation hauls, seven to 10 days prevails. I budget twelve, then I am happy if it appears in eight. City couple with hefty carrier traffic, like Southern The Golden State to the Dallas hallway, relocate quicker. Sparse paths right into the Mountain West can run slower, especially if your home rests far off the interstate.
Choosing a cars and truck transporter with eyes open
Two parts of the market issue to you: service providers that own vehicles and brokers that match products to service providers. Most home actions touch a broker even if you never see the word on a contract, since brokers build the nationwide provider network and fill trucks. That is not an issue by itself. It ends up being an issue when a broker can not or will certainly not veterinarian the vehicle they designate, or when a dispatcher goes away the moment a claim appears.
Here is an easy way to review a companion without transforming it right into a research study task:
- Verify the DOT and MC numbers and search for security and insurance policy information on the FMCSA website. Ask who holds the cargo insurance policy and the restriction. One hundred thousand bucks per tons prevails. Greater is much better if you have a new SUV or a high value vehicle. Request a created pick-up window and a delivery quote that makes up weekend breaks and ports if applicable. Read current reviews for "interaction" and "cases handling," not simply price. Confirm whether the business is a broker, a service provider, or both, and obtain the name of the real vehicle firm assigned when dispatched.
Open transport works well for many typical lorries. It is cost effective and commonly offered. Enclosed transport prices much more, commonly 30 to 60 percent much more, and it makes sense for classics, unique automobiles, and freshly brought back automobiles that need added defense. Incurable to incurable shipping lowers price yet includes days and an added handoff. Door to door is simpler for family members juggling kids and base check outs, however it can still mean conference at a broad road near your home if your neighborhood has tight turns, reduced trees, or HOA restrictions.
Paperwork that secures you
You indication two records that matter greater than any kind of pamphlet. The very first is the Expense of Lading, which is the contract of carriage. The second is the problem record, occasionally folded up into the Bill of Lading. Treat the condition report like a vehicle examination at a rental counter, other than it protects your vehicle, not their own. Walk the car with the vehicle driver, mark every scrape, and photograph the panels and wheels in good lights. Tag the odometer and any warning lights on the dashboard. Note aftermarket products like roof covering racks or spoilers. On shipment, repeat the walkdown. If you see damage that was not noted at pickup, write it on the form prior to you authorize and take clear pictures. Then notify the dispatcher promptly. Clean paperwork moves declares onward. Vague tales go nowhere.
Insurance language can really feel slippery. Ask straight concerns. Who pays if a band messes up the paint? Is road particles covered while the car experiences on an open service provider? What happens if the roof covering antenna snaps? Several plans exclude disasters and road debris. Protection can be additional to your individual automobile policy. If you have a pricey lorry, call your insurance company in advance and ask just how your thorough and collision protection uses throughout transport. You may determine to lug a reduced insurance deductible for the month of the move.
Preparing the lorry so pick-up is smooth
A vehicle that prepares to load gets on the initial offered truck. A cars and truck that surprises the driver with a drained pipes battery or 4 loose moving boxes in the trunk rests till someone sorts it out. Do the very easy job so you are not the factor a vehicle misses its route.
- Wash the outside, get rid of individual items, and shoot outdated images. Tidy vehicles make damage simpler to detect and document. A light wash is enough. Service what matters for packing. Inspect tire pressure, battery health and wellness, and liquid leakages. If it starts and guides, it typically ships. Severe leaks that drip onto lower deck automobiles can obtain you rejected at the curb. Set the gas to regarding a quarter storage tank. Less gas is safer and commonly required. Do not deliver gas containers or flammables. Disable alarms and toll tags, and keep one complete set of tricks convenient. If your automobile has a concealed kill button, inform the driver. Remove or safe loose devices. Antennas, ski shelfs, removable looters, and aftermarket fog lights typically experience in transit if left on.
If your vehicle is unusable, tell the dispatcher in advance. Winching a non-runner onto a trailer is practical, however it changes the kind of truck that can accept the work, and it typically includes a couple of hundred dollars. If your parking place beings in a limited garage or a dead-end cul-de-sac, hunt a vast pickup factor nearby and inform the vehicle driver. Service providers need long, straight approaches and space to turn.

Overseas and port realities
Port routines run on their very own clock. Roll-on, roll-off vessels load cars swiftly, but they hold hundreds of systems, and departure slots can shift. When your orders involve a car transport Bay Area port, think a few unchecked days at both ends. Your vehicle may sit in a safe lawn for a week before it boards, and then a week after it lands while it removes. You can influence the front end by delivering to the port early in the ship window and arriving with a clean, completely dry auto. Some ports deny vehicles with dirty undercarriages to stop transfer of intrusive varieties. If the port needs a heavy steam clean, it adds time and a tiny fee.
On the backside, factor regional regulations. European Union ports usually need evidence of ownership, ticket, and orders, all matching precisely. A missing out on middle preliminary has actually postponed more than one pickup. In island locations, room restraints can compel pick-up at a remote great deal. Call the vehicle processing center, not just the provider, a week before arrival to confirm.
Shipping bikes, classics, and EVs
Special automobiles relocate with the exact same basics, however details matter.
Motorcycles ride in dog crates or on specialized pallets with soft bands, wheel chocks, and bars to protect controls. Inform the carrier the exact model and any alterations. Side instances and windscreens require extra padding or removal. Fuel should be reduced, and the battery accessible if it needs detaching during sea transit.
Classic autos and reveal vehicles take advantage of enclosed providers and higher insurance coverage limitations. Low ground clearance needs liftgate service. Step the clearance and share it. I have viewed a chauffeur construct a ramp extension from lumber to pack a museum-grade coupe. The added 200 bucks for the right gear really felt cheap in that moment.
Electric automobiles ship penalty on both open and enclosed providers, but they include creases. Numerous service providers request a state of fee in between 20 and 30 percent to handle fire risk and weight. Supply the typical mobile charger in the trunk and verify the tow hook area in the owner's guidebook. A level battery on a trailer creates uncomfortable hours for every person. Likewise divulge aftermarket wraps or ceramic layers. Soft straps still abrade if positioned on newly layered surface areas without protection.
